In-Depth Game Analysis
What if your choices could rewrite an entire story, not just its ending? That is the core promise of Scripts: Episode & Choices, an interactive fiction mobile game that blurs the line between reading a visual novel and starring in one. It belongs squarely in the choose-your-own-adventure genre, but with a twist: you do not just pick dialogue options; you actively craft scenes, develop relationships, and unlock branching pathways that feel genuinely consequential. This game is a treat for narrative junkies, especially those who crave romance, mystery, or fantasy settings with a heavy dose of player agency. What caught my attention was the social media buzz from players showing off their unique story outcomes. Everyone's playthrough seemed to be completely different, which sparked my curiosity far more than any polished trailer could.
Diving in, I expected a casual experience but found myself oddly invested within the first hour. The fun does not hit you immediately; it takes a bit of patience during the exposition. But once you get a handle on the 'choice' system, where your decisions unlock hidden character traits or alter key events, the immersion becomes powerful. The controls are straightforward tap-and-swipe, perfect for one-handed play on the bus. Performance was smooth on my mid-range device, with no lag during the animated cutscenes. A standout moment for me was in a mystery episode where I chose to accuse a character based on a tiny detail from a previous chapter. The game remembered that choice and completely shifted the suspect pool for the final act. That level of continuity kept me glued to the screen. I also tweaked the text speed and turned off the auto-play to savor the dialogue, which greatly improved the pacing.
As someone who has played dozens of interactive novels from Choice of Games to Episode, I stuck with Scripts because of its 'consequence density' — every chapter feels packed with meaningful forks, not filler. It outshines many competitors because it does not gatekeep the best story routes behind premium currency as aggressively. The writing is also more mature and less cliche than similar offerings, with twists that genuinely caught me off guard. What really worked was the social element: you can see how other players voted on key decisions, which adds a fun layer of community without making it a multiplayer game. For fans of narrative-driven content who want to feel like the author of their own story, this one earns its spot on your home screen — just be ready to lose track of time.
Core Gameplay Features
- Branching Storylines 🔀: Every major decision you make splits the narrative into new paths. Your choices directly affect character relationships, available chapters, and the final outcome. It is not just about picking the 'right' answer; your personality dictates the route.
- Customizable Avatars 🎨: You can design your main character from scratch, including hairstyles, outfits, and facial features. This customization extends to your wardrobe throughout the story, with certain outfits unlocking unique dialogue options or romantic interests.
- Riddle & Puzzle Integration 🧩: Not all progression is based on dialogue. Some episodes feature riddles, clue-finding sequences, or logic puzzles that you must solve to advance the plot. Failing these might lock you into a less desirable story branch.
- Chapter Replay System 🔄: After finishing an episode, you can replay any chapter to make different choices. Your choices are saved per slot, allowing you to explore 'what if' scenarios without resetting your entire save file.
Strengths & Highlights
- Consequential Choice Design 🧠: The game rarely pulls its punches. A seemingly minor choice in Chapter 2 can drastically alter a character's loyalty or survival in Chapter 8. It respects your decisions and makes every tap feel weighty.
- Mature & Engaging Writing ✍️: The dialogue avoids being cringe-worthy or overly simplistic. Characters feel like real people with conflicting motives. The emotional beats land more often than not, especially in the romance and thriller categories.
- Generous Free-to-Play Model 💰: You can progress through most of the story without spending a dime. The premium choices are well-telegraphed and usually just provide a 'better' outcome, not the only logical one. You rarely hit a paywall that stops you cold.
Limitations to Consider
- Slow Start in Some Episodes 🐌: The first few chapters of a new story often dump too much exposition and setup. It can feel like a drag before the real choices start appearing. Some players might lose interest before the hook sinks in.
- Limited Art Variety for Side Characters 🎭: While your main avatar is highly customizable, the supporting cast in different episodes often share the same face or body model. This can break immersion, especially when a character is supposed to be unique.
- Energy System Fatigue ⏳: You are limited by a stamina bar for reading chapters. Once empty, you have to wait for it to refill or spend in-game currency. It slows down binge-reading sessions and feels like an artificial restriction on engagement.
